140 - THE INNER WORLD: THE PSYCHOLOGY AND SPIRITUALITY OF LIFE TRANSITIONS
Jack Shea / Jim Zullo
In the past, stability was considered the norm and transition the exception. Today transition is the norm and stability is the exception. In this atmosphere there has been extensive study and reflection on transition from social-psychological and spiritual points of view. We will examine some of the basic features of transitions and their accompanying dynamics of loss, grief, and renewal. We will also explore the invitations to spiritual development within transitions.

240 - NURTURING HOPE: RECLAIMING OUR STORY
Barbara Fiand, SND de Namur
What do we have to let go of in order to reclaim the power that is ours by virtue of our faith in Jesus Christ? We will explore this question and together face the idols that have kept us from walking into our story with the strength of our convictions. What is that story, and who is Jesus as our pathway and salvation? What, in fact, is salvation, and how can we understand it today in a time-relevant manner? What are the charter moments of our faith that empower us toward transformation? Our time together will be spent exploring these questions.
